## Further Reading

Reviewing changes to the Tallyhawk billing worker? Worth knowing how our blue-green flow works first — traffic flips only after the idle color drains its queue, so "looks fine in green" isn't the whole story. Cutover criteria, rollback timing, and queue-drain gotchas are all written up on the internal deploy guide here.

runbook for badug-kadup: https://confluence.zemvarlabs.internal/projects/browse/display/projects/bd1b

09:05 — The Stacklore catalogue import stalled halfway through the Rowanmere branch's records. The parser choked on a malformed subject heading introduced by the previous night's vendor feed. Import resumed at 09:40 after the bad rows were quarantined. New folks: quarantined rows live in the holding table, not the dead-letter queue. The fix shipped in the build tokened below.

session token of fafof-bahof = htk9_cde2d95fb

Subject: Solara Line Pricing Update

Team,

Effective next quarter, list prices on the Solara range increase 4% to offset component costs. Bundled maintenance pricing is unchanged. Finance should update forecasts and flag any contracts locked at old rates. Please keep this internal until the announcement. The rationale tied to our broader plans is summarised below.

board note of baweg-bawig: Project Tamath slips by six weeks because of the audit delay.

# FeeForge Environments

Quick refresher for reviewers: FeeForge, our shipping-fee rules engine, runs in three environments — sandbox, staging, and prod. Rule changes only matter if the environment they land in actually evaluates them, so double-check which tier a PR targets. Staging mirrors prod traffic from the Caldmere region at 10% sampling. The staging instance currently runs with these settings.

deployment values, faduf-tawep:
SORDOR_LOG_LEVEL=error
SORDOR_METRICS_HOST=metrics.sordor.nelvrolabs.internal
SORDOR_POOL_SIZE=4